A woman was shot to death late Wednesday morning inside a home on Olive Street in Gert Town, New Orleans police said.

Police were called to a complaint of “possible forced entry into a residence” near the 7800 block of Olive (between Fern and Lowerline streets) at 11:11 a.m. Wednesday, June 14, according to a NOPD report.

“En route to the location, officers received a call of shots fired in the same area,” according to the report. “Upon arrival at about 11:15 a.m., officers discovered inside the residence the unresponsive body of a female suffering from multiple gunshot wounds.”

She was pronounced dead at the scene, the report states.

Another man was injured in a shooting overnight in the same block of Olive Street, but police have not said whether the two incidents are related.
